According to Mars Finance, on April 18, Ali Yahya, a general partner at a16z crypto, posted on social media that the institution has additionally invested $55 million to purchase LayerZero's ZRO tokens, with a lock-up period of 3 years. Ali Yahya added that the global financial system is continuously evolving, and he is pleased to see that the protocol enables many new businesses and complex workflows to move on-chain.
